Ok I found a 30 bottle wine cooler on Craigslist I got it for $70 I took out all the cooling stuff (compressor and all copper tubing) mainly to make it not so heavy... I was able to re-wire the light to be able to plug into the wall outlet... What I'm wandering now is what you guys think I should use to heat it and where to place the heat source and I'm also wandering if I should use a fan to make sure their is not hot spots like in the stickie with the sobe fridge and just in case you need to know the inside dimensions are 32"h x 16"w x 17"d I am looking for any and all advice on how i should go about making this into a incubator (heat,humidity,fan etc) thank you all in advance

Heat tape down the back. Start thete and then see how much of a fan you may need.
